Blockchain technology has revolutionized numerous industries, but its inherent scalability limitations have been a persistent challenge. As the demand for blockchain applications increases, traditional blockchains struggle to process transactions efficiently and reduce latency. This is where Layer Two (L2) Block comes into play, offering a promising solution to enhance blockchain scalability.
- Layer Two Block solutions operate on top of existing blockchains, utilizing alternative transaction processing methods to alleviate congestion on the main chain.
- By executing transactions off-chain, L2 blocks can process data at a significantly higher rate compared to traditional Layer One blockchains.
- Furthermore, L2 Block solutions often offer lower transaction fees, making blockchain applications more affordable.
With its ability to optimize scalability and reduce costs, Layer Two Block is poised to play a crucial role in unlocking the full potential of blockchain technology. As developers and businesses research innovative L2 solutions, we can anticipate a future where blockchain applications are faster, more efficient, and accessible to a wider audience.

Two-Block for Layered Hair
If you're rocking layers and searching for a style that accentuates their definition, the two-block might be your go-to solution. This classic cut features noticeably shorter hair on the bottom layer, seamlessly transitioning a longer, softer top section. It's remarkably flexible, working well for all hair types.
- Picture this: a two-block cut can give your layers a boost of texture, making them pop and truly shine.
- The contrast between the lengths creates an eye-catching silhouette.
- Regardless of how long your hair is, the two-block can be personalized to suit your individual style.
